  • better digestion tip part 15

    if you pack your mouth full of food per reload... 1. harder to bite all the food in your mouth. 2. the saliva doesn't get painted on all the food in your mouth for breakdown 3. the food on your plate ends up gulped down way too quickly not giving enough time for stomach to send signal to brain that it is full. 4. forcing large amounts of food down at once, can't be a good thing.

    so, if i finish a cup of food in 5 reloads usually... then i double that to 10. smaller serving size per reload to the mouth is a good way to increase the quality of digestion and prevents over-eating.

    hmm.. the above doesn't quite sound right. maybe if i change the wording..... maybe the right way to say it is....

    don't eat a mouthful of food at a time. load your mouth about 25% capacity.
